Silicon Motion Technology Corporation, a leader in NAND flash controllers for solid-state storage devices, has achieved ISO 26262 functional safety process certification for its automotive applications.
This certification is a significant milestone for the company, underscoring its commitment to providing safe, reliable, and intelligent storage solutions for the automotive industry. The ISO 26262 standard is crucial for ensuring the functional safety of electrical and electronic systems in road vehicles. By aligning its engineering workflows and quality systems with these requirements, Silicon Motion enhances its capability to support advanced automotive applications such as intelligent cockpit platforms, ADAS, telematics, digital dashboards, and AI-driven in-vehicle storage systems. The company continues to expand its automotive storage portfolio to meet the growing demand for high-reliability data storage in next-generation vehicles.
